So I've got the EMU 0404 and I like it a great deal, but I do have another concern on my mind.

How on earth do I rig my machine to play the 5.1 surround from a DVD? Is there a way to add this on (through another card, perhaps) to my system? I don't really care about 5.1 sound in games, I mostly wear my headphones when I'm playing and haven't had any of the sound problems some people say they've got with the 0404.

But, when I get home from a few days in studio, I'd like to be able to watch DVDs on my Apple Cinema display (I thought I'd be doing more of my own work on this thing... *sigh*) and have 5.1 surround. From the DVD drive to my Pioneer stereo, what do I need inbetween?

And will the inbetween stuff be compatible with my EMU 0404?
 
Oct 13, 2005 at 2:06 AM Post #2 of 3
You should be able to set your player software to use SP/DIF passthrough so the AC3/DTS stream is passed to your receiver for decoding. This is assuming you're using SP/DIF.
